Cannot upload file

(1)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 169
I encountered an issue where I am unable to upload a file. There is no error message, but the file does not appear after the upload.
Anyone else having this issue?
Thank you.

    Hi,
    Have you checked file extension and file size (max now is 512MB)? Supported document types can be found here: Use uploaded documents for generative answers - Microsoft Copilot Studio | Microsoft Learn
     
    Anyway, you can go through the uploaded documents in your copilot having a look at the following dataverse table: Copilot component (botcomponent) table/entity reference (Microsoft Dataverse) - Power Apps | Microsoft Learn
     
    Hope that helps!
